South Africa – A Rainbow Nation of Adventures

South Africa is a country where diverse cultures, dramatic landscapes, and incredible wildlife meet. From safari thrills in Kruger National Park to cosmopolitan vibes in Cape Town, wine routes in Stellenbosch, and the iconic Table Mountain, South Africa offers a journey full of contrasts. Whether you’re chasing the Big Five, surfing world-class waves, or road-tripping along the Garden Route, every corner tells a different story.


Altitude

  • Highest Point: Mafadi Peak – 3,450 m (Drakensberg Mountains)
  • Major Cities: Johannesburg ~1,753 m, Cape Town ~0 m (sea level)

Distance from Airport / Railway Station

  • OR Tambo International Airport (Johannesburg) is the main gateway.
  • Cape Town International Airport serves the Western Cape region.
  • Well-connected railway network for scenic routes like the Blue Train.

Best Time to Visit

  • May to September: Best for safaris (dry season).
  • November to March: Perfect for beaches and coastal adventures.

Top Attractions

  • Kruger National Park: Safari heaven with lions, leopards, rhinos, elephants, and buffalo.
  • Cape Town & Table Mountain: Panoramic city and ocean views.
  • Garden Route: Coastal road trip paradise.
  • Robben Island: Nelson Mandela’s prison and historical landmark.
  • Drakensberg Mountains: Hiking and scenic drives.
  • Winelands: Stellenbosch, Franschhoek, and Paarl for wine tasting.

Adventure Activities

  • Big Five safaris.
  • Shark cage diving in Gansbaai.
  • Surfing at Jeffreys Bay.
  • Bungee jumping at Bloukrans Bridge.
  • Hiking in Drakensberg.

How to Reach

  • By Air: OR Tambo (Johannesburg) and Cape Town airports have global connections.
  • By Road: Cross-border buses from Namibia, Botswana, Mozambique, and Zimbabwe.
  • By Train: Luxury trains like Rovos Rail and the Blue Train offer scenic travel.

Ideal Trip Duration

10–14 days to cover major cities, safaris, and coastal routes.


Final Tip: South Africa is best enjoyed by mixing urban experiences with nature—start with Cape Town, move to the Garden Route, and end with a Kruger safari.
